Job Summary This position requires the person in the role to work on-site approximately 4 times per week at up to three practices within the program's East Region (Boston, MA). The Patient Navigator is responsible for working closely with patients, families, and healthcare providers to ensure a seamless and patient-centered care experience by assisting with navigating the complexities of the healthcare system, coordinating resources, and providing support to improve patient outcomes Essential Functions -Advocate for patients and their families, ensuring their needs and preferences are considered in the care planning process. -Serve as a liaison between patients, healthcare providers, and other relevant stakeholders. -Collaborate with the interdisciplinary healthcare team to coordinate patient care services, appointments, and follow-up plans. -Assist patients in understanding and adhering to their care plans. -Identify and connect patients with appropriate healthcare and community resources, such as support groups, financial assistance programs, and transportation services. -Educate patients and their families about their medical conditions, treatment options, and self-care strategies. -Ensure that patients are informed and empowered to actively participate in their healthcare decisions. -Maintain accurate and detailed documentation of patient interactions, care plans, and resource referrals. Qualifications Qualifications: Bachelor's Degree in related field of study required. Relevant experience may be accepted in lieu of a degree. 1+ years of experience in social work, community health, case management or related field required, preferably in a clinical setting. Additional Knowledge, Skills and Abilities: Strong knowledge of healthcare resources, community services, and patient advocacy. Excellent commun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to collaborate effectively with healthcare professionals across multiple disciplines and experiences. Strong organizational and time management skills.
